yeah, it sucks. on the upper manual, right hand manual preset (Corresponds with B- far rightmost preset) - there's a 5th harmonic overtone getting through somehow when all the drawbars are turned off.
On the other manual preset (Bb) - it's fine.
On the lower manual (both setting) - it's fine.
Any ideas of how to fix or trouble shoot this issue. Just started in the past few weeks.

Does switching percussion on/off have any influence?
Usually, percussion is triggered off the topmost (1') drawbar, which is the sixth harmonic, I guess. When percussion is switched on, that drawbar's harmonic is killed.
I've heard of mods that restore the harmonic even when percussion is on, or that route it to a different drawbar in order to enable the octave overtone - maybe something shorted there?

This usually indicates a partial short in that circuit.
Thankfully, these are built like ancient cars, where it is easy to trace a problem on an individual button or drawbar.
As analogika stated, try switching on / off the percussion section, and se if that influences at all.
http://theatreorgans.com/hammond/faq/a-100/a-100.html
That has all the service manuals, plus some experts on all things Hammond. I am sure if you are patient, you can fix it yourself.
